Here is the best advice that I can give to anyone in a relationship or trying to start one.
1. Genuinely laugh often with your partner.
2. Spend quality time with no distractions.
This means no TV, computer and especially, no phones.
3. Go on spontaneous dates.
4. Tell your partner, “I appreciate you” and expound if they ask.
5. If you tell anyone the bad parts of your relationship, then also tell them the good.
But this doesn’t mean you should tell everyone about your relationship.
6. Love is a verb, not a noun.
7. Your partner is not the source of your happiness.
He/she just complements it.
8. Have a life outside of your relationship.
9. Admit when you’re wrong.
10. Don’t ever think you can change your partner.
11. Accept responsibility.
12. Don’t be interesting. Be interested.
Show interest in your partner.
13. Argue productively.
If there isn’t a solution or compromise, there are bigger problems.
14. Don’t belittle your partner.
15. Share chores/tasks/responsibilities.
16. Take into account their feelings.
About anything. What your partner says matters.
17. Don’t be afraid to ask for what you need.
18. Openly communicate with your partner.
19. Never begin a sentence with “You,” but “I” instead to express your feelings, not your thoughts.
20. Don’t keep secrets from your partner. Including lying by omission.
21. Never assume.
22. Put in the effort you want put into the relationship by your partner.
In other words, work to make it work.
